by mothergarage
What has changed in Live 9 is, that the user remote scripts are sorted alphabetically, while before they were at the bottom of the list. Second is that a MPK mini script is included with 9 and gets selected if a Mini is connected. Maybe Live dumps some settings to the Mini.
All this aside the script works as expected. Maybe select the user remote script (you might want to rename the folder it sits in, to identify it in the drop down menu) and upload the presets once more to the Mini.

You should rename the folder you copied to the "User Remote Scripts" folder, the one provided by Ableton will be changed if you update. But this is just to distinguish them. The location of that folder depends on your operating system.

Windows: Users\<Your Username>\App Data\Roaming\Ableton\<Live Version>\Preferences\User Remote Scripts

Mac: Macintosh HD>Users>[yourusername]>Library>Preferences>Ableton>[Live Version]>User Remote Scripts
